Newcastle Launches Mammoth €80M Bid for RB Leipzig Star Striker Benjamin Sesko

Newcastle United has reportedly launched a staggering €80 million bid for highly-rated RB Leipzig striker Benjamin Sesko, signaling a significant move in the upcoming football transfer window.

The comprehensive offer for the talented Slovenian forward is understood to be structured with an initial payment of €75 million (£65.5m; $86.9m) paid upfront, complemented by an additional €5 million in performance-related add-ons, making it a substantial investment from the Premier League club.

This substantial bid was officially tabled by the Tyneside club within the last 24 hours, underscoring their serious intent to secure the services of the 22-year-old as they look to bolster their attacking options.

Sources close to the negotiations suggest that Newcastle’s aggressive pursuit of Sesko is intricately linked to the potential departure of Swedish international Alexander Isak, who is reportedly seeking a transfer away from St. James’ Park this summer.

In a parallel development, rival Premier League giants Manchester United have also expressed a keen interest in acquiring Sesko, adding another layer of intrigue to what is rapidly becoming one of the most compelling player movement sagas of the summer.

Despite the intense attention from two of England’s biggest clubs, the Slovenia international has yet to make a definitive choice regarding his preferred destination, indicating that the final decision rests firmly with the promising young striker.
